pkcs15-crypt.1.xml: sort options alphabetically

This commit is contained in:
Peter Marschall 2011-08-21 12:33:13 +02:00
parent 77d051ffc5
commit d6a9cda78b
1 changed files with 67 additions and 64 deletions

View File

@ -36,43 +36,11 @@
<variablelist>
<varlistentry>
<term>
<option>--sign</option>,
<option>-s</option>
<option>--aid</option> <replaceable>aid</replaceable>
</term>
<listitem><para>Perform digital signature operation on
the data read from a file specified using the <option>--input</option>
option. By default, the contents of the file are assumed to
be the result of an MD5 hash operation. Note that <command>pkcs15-crypt</command>
expects the data in binary representation, not ASCII.</para>
<para>The digital signature is stored, in binary representation,
in the file specified by the <option>--output</option> option. If
this option is not given, the signature is printed on standard
output, displaying non-printable characters using their hex notation
xNN (see also <option>--raw</option>).</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--pkcs1</option>
</term>
<listitem><para>By default, <command>pkcs15-crypt</command>
assumes that input data has been padded to the correct length
(i.e. when computing an RSA signature using a 1024 bit key,
the input must be padded to 128 bytes to match the modulus
length). When giving the <option>--pkcs1</option> option,
however, <command>pkcs15-crypt</command> will perform the
required padding using the algorithm outlined in the
PKCS #1 standard version 1.5.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--sha-1</option>
</term>
<listitem><para>This option tells <command>pkcs15-crypt</command>
that the input file is the result of an SHA1 hash operation,
rather than an MD5 hash. Again, the data must be in binary
representation.</para></listitem>
<listitem><para>Specify the AID of the on-card PKCS#15 applicationi
to bind to. The <replaceable>aid</replaceable> must be in hexadecimal
form.</para></listitem>
</varlistentry>
<varlistentry>
@ -89,25 +57,6 @@
<option>--raw</option>).</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--key</option> <replaceable>id</replaceable>,
<option>-k</option> <replaceable>id</replaceable>
</term>
<listitem><para>Selects the ID of the key to use.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--reader</option> <replaceable>N</replaceable>,
<option>-r</option> <replaceable>N</replaceable>
</term>
<listitem><para>Selects the <replaceable>N</replaceable>-th smart
card reader configured by the system. If unspecified,
<command>pkcs15-crypt</command> will use the first reader
found.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--input</option> <replaceable>file</replaceable>,
@ -118,18 +67,18 @@
<varlistentry>
<term>
<option>--output</option> <replaceable>file</replaceable>,
<option>-o</option> <replaceable>file</replaceable>
<option>--key</option> <replaceable>id</replaceable>,
<option>-k</option> <replaceable>id</replaceable>
</term>
<listitem><para>Any output will be sent to the specified file.</para></listitem>
<listitem><para>Selects the ID of the key to use.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--raw</option>,
<option>-R</option>
<option>--output</option> <replaceable>file</replaceable>,
<option>-o</option> <replaceable>file</replaceable>
</term>
<listitem><para>Outputs raw 8 bit data.</para></listitem>
<listitem><para>Any output will be sent to the specified file.</para></listitem>
</varlistentry>
<varlistentry>
@ -150,10 +99,64 @@
<varlistentry>
<term>
<option>--aid</option> <replaceable>aid</replaceable>
<option>--pkcs1</option>
</term>
<listitem><para>Specify in a hexadecimal form the AID of the on-card PKCS#15
application to be binded to.</para></listitem>
<listitem><para>By default, <command>pkcs15-crypt</command>
assumes that input data has been padded to the correct length
(i.e. when computing an RSA signature using a 1024 bit key,
the input must be padded to 128 bytes to match the modulus
length). When giving the <option>--pkcs1</option> option,
however, <command>pkcs15-crypt</command> will perform the
required padding using the algorithm outlined in the
PKCS #1 standard version 1.5.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--raw</option>,
<option>-R</option>
</term>
<listitem><para>Outputs raw 8 bit data.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--reader</option> <replaceable>N</replaceable>,
<option>-r</option> <replaceable>N</replaceable>
</term>
<listitem><para>Selects the <replaceable>N</replaceable>-th smart
card reader configured by the system. If unspecified,
<command>pkcs15-crypt</command> will use the first reader
found.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--sha-1</option>
</term>
<listitem><para>This option tells <command>pkcs15-crypt</command>
that the input file is the result of an SHA1 hash operation,
rather than an MD5 hash. Again, the data must be in binary
representation.</para></listitem>
</varlistentry>
<varlistentry>
<term>
<option>--sign</option>,
<option>-s</option>
</term>
<listitem><para>Perform digital signature operation on
the data read from a file specified using the <option>--input</option>
option. By default, the contents of the file are assumed to
be the result of an MD5 hash operation.
Note that <command>pkcs15-crypt</command>
expects the data in binary representation, not ASCII.</para>
<para>The digital signature is stored, in binary representation,
in the file specified by the <option>--output</option> option. If
this option is not given, the signature is printed on standard
output, displaying non-printable characters using their hex notation
<literal>x</literal><replaceable>NN</replaceable>
(see also <option>--raw</option>).</para></listitem>
</varlistentry>
<varlistentry>